About Kangaroo Point 2224

The size of Kangaroo Point is approximately 0.8 square kilometres. It has 1 park covering nearly 0.5% of total area. The population of Kangaroo Point in 2016 was 560 people. By 2021 the population was 602 showing a population growth of 7.5%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Kangaroo Point is 50-59 years. Households in Kangaroo Point are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ying over $4000 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Kangaroo Point work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 92.60% of the homes in Kangaroo Point were owner-occupied compared with 89.30% in 2016.
